sql查询 查询开头为指定的内容
时间: 2024-04-12 08:30:26 浏览: 19
你可以使用 SQL 的 `LIKE` 运算符来查询开头为指定内容的数据。以下是一个示例查询语句:
```sql
SELECT * FROM 表名 WHERE 列名 LIKE '指定内容%'
```
在上述语句中,将 `表名` 替换为你要查询的表的名称,将 `列名` 替换为你要查询的列的名称,将 `指定内容` 替换为你希望匹配的开头内容。
例如,如果你有一个名为 `users` 的表,其中有一个名为 `username` 的列,你想查询用户名以 "john" 开头的所有用户,你可以使用以下查询语句:
```sql
SELECT * FROM users WHERE username LIKE 'john%'
```
这将返回所有用户名以 "john" 开头的用户记录。
相关问题
mybatis sql查询 查询开头为指定的内容
在 MyBatis 中,你可以使用 `${}` 占位符来构建动态 SQL 查询语句。以下是一个示例:
```xml
<select id="selectByPrefix" parameterType="java.lang.String" resultType="your.package.YourEntity">
SELECT * FROM your_table WHERE your_column LIKE ${prefix}%
</select>
```
在上述示例中,`selectByPrefix` 是你定义的查询语句的 ID,`your.package.YourEntity` 是你的实体类的包路径和类名,`your_table` 是你要查询的表名,`your_column` 是你要查询的列名,`${prefix}` 是一个占位符,表示查询的开头内容。
然后,你可以通过传递参数来执行这个查询语句。例如,在 Java 代码中调用:
```java
String prefix = "指定内容";
List<YourEntity> result = sqlSession.selectList("selectByPrefix", prefix);
```
这样就能执行查询并返回开头为指定内容的数据列表。请根据你的实际情况修改表名、列名、实体类以及占位符名称。
SQLSERVER查询9,N开头的数据
### 回答1:
如果您想要查询数据库中以字母 "N" 开头的字段,可以使用下面的查询语句:
```
SELECT * FROM 表名 WHERE 字段名 LIKE 'N%';
```
这将返回所有以字母 "N" 开头的字段。如果您还想要返回以数字 "9" 开头的字段,可以使用以下查询语句:
```
SELECT * FROM 表名 WHERE 字段名 LIKE '9%';
```
这将返回所有以数字 "9" 开头的字段。如果您想要同时查询以 "9" 和 "N" 开头的字段,可以使用下面的查询语句:
```
SELECT * FROM 表名 WHERE 字段名 LIKE '9%' OR 字段名 LIKE 'N%';
```
这将返回所有以 "9" 或 "N" 开头的字段。
注意:
- 请确保替换 "表名" 和 "字段名" 为你的表名和字段名。
- 使用 "LIKE" 运算符和 "%" 符号来查询以指定字符开头的字段。
- 使用 "OR" 运算符来查询多个条件。
### 回答2:
在SQL Server中查询以9和N开头的数据,我们可以使用LIKE运算符结合通配符来实现。
使用LIKE '%9%'可以匹配任意位置包含9的值。
使用LIKE 'N%'可以匹配以N开头的值。
我们可以使用OR运算符将两个条件组合起来,如下所示:
SELECT * FROM 表名
WHERE 列名 LIKE '%9%' OR 列名 LIKE 'N%'
在上面的代码中,将表名替换为要查询的表名,将列名替换为要查询的列名。
这样,查询结果将包括所有以9开头的值以及以N开头的值。
### 回答3:
可以使用SQLSERVER里的LIKE语句来查询以9或N开头的数据。具体的查询语句如下:
SELECT * FROM 表名
WHERE 列名 LIKE '9%' OR 列名 LIKE 'N%';
以上查询语句中,“表名”是你要查询的表的名称,“列名”是你要查询的列的名称。通过LIKE语句加上通配符%,可以匹配以9或者N开头的数据。其中%表示任意字符。
例如,如果你要查询一个名为“学生”的表中,名字列以9或N开头的数据,可以使用以下查询语句:
SELECT * FROM 学生
WHERE 姓名 LIKE '9%' OR 姓名 LIKE 'N%';
注意,查询结果会包括以9或N开头的数据,不论是大小写。如果需要区分大小写,可以使用 COLLATE语句加上不同的排序规则指定。
希望以上回答对你有帮助!